About Manuel Seco

Manuel Seco is a scholar working on Language and Linguistics, Classics, Conservation, History and Philosophy of Science and Education, having authored 24 papers that have together received 303 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Spanish Linguistics and Language Studies (21 papers), Historical Linguistics and Language Studies (8 papers), Linguistic Studies and Language Acquisition (4 papers), Literacy and Educational Practices (4 papers), Lexicography and Language Studies (3 papers), Medieval Iberian Studies (2 papers), Archaeological and Historical Studies (1 paper) and Comparative Literary Analysis and Criticism (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Language and Linguistics (232 citations), Linguistics and Language (65 citations), Communication (39 citations), Experimental and Cognitive Psychology (36 citations) and General Arts and Humanities (3 citations). Manuel Seco has collaborated with scholars based in Spain. Frequent co-authors include Juan Alonso, Ramón Menéndez Pidal and Rafael Lapesa. Their work appears in journals such as Hispanic Review, International Journal of Lexicography, Boletín de filología, Hispania and Medical Entomology and Zoology.
